Breakdown

Theater’s statement: “We are especially committed to an ethnically diverse cast, and we are particularly interested in older and younger African-American, Asian, and multi-ethnic actors. Experience with classical drama is essential. We are an experimental theater company and actors must be comfortable with unorthodox approaches and unusual treatment of text. We seek actors who are comfortable trying things without knowing why.”

The 2015 / 2016 season launches our Eugene O’Neill program, featuring work based on MOURNING BECOMES ELECTRA, O’Neill’s great trilogy, as the spine of our work. MOURNING is unusually large, comprising three complete plays and many hours on stage, so we plan to phase it in to create ample time for artistic development. In February 2016, in the Abrons Arts Center’s historic Playhouse, we will present DRUNKEN WITH WHAT? based on the first part of the trilogy, HOMECOMING. In this initial production, the first in our multi-year exploration of MOURNING, Director David Herskovits will test a variety of ways of breaking up the text and staging, designers will test ideas about the physical shape of the production, and performers will test different stylistic approaches to the material.

We are seeking ensemble members (men and women) employed on a principal contract. Roles may be overlapped or shared.
